Synopsis

Diana, a single mother, faces the challenge of supporting her child while also working toward her college education. After meeting two dancers from a nearby gentlemen's club, she becomes convinced that stripping offers a path to quick financial relief.

Why 2.5×?

Cinemas keep roughly half of every ticket sold, and a wide release’s marketing often costs about as much again as the film — so a movie needs to gross around 2.5× its production budget just to break even theatrically. It’s a rule of thumb, not the studio’s ledger (home video and streaming come later).
